Nano-sized and sub-micron carbide powders for thermal spraying

HVOF sprayed WC-Co(Cr) coatings are typically used to prevent wear and corrosion. In order to improve coating properties and economical efficiency of coatings, process development of feedstock powders and spraying processes are required. Denser coatings with reduced as-sprayed surface roughness were obtained by reduction of carbide and agglomerate sizes. According to early studies, using the conventional HVOF process damages the desired nano-structure during spraying. Therefore, in this study a new thermal spray system called CJS (Carbide Jet Spray) was utilised. CJS has colder process parameters, so the structure of fine particles and their properties are more easily preserved. Commercial and experimental powders with different carbide and particle sizes were sprayed with CJS and the resulting coatings were analysed.
